Has anyone figured out how to attach a stormraven's side doors so that they swing open? I've assembled the front door properly and, between magnets and wire, worked out a way to set the back door so it sits more or less in the proper position, though I'm going to need to do some messing around with plasticard to get it just so. The side doors, though, are still confounding me.

For context, I've decided not to use the hurricane bolters. If at a future point I decide to use them, I'll attach them somewhere else - the stormraven is supposed to have side doors, and covering them with bolters irks me.
